Font Size: a A A

Research And Design Of Internet Of Things Resource Access System

Posted on:2021-05-22Degree:MasterType:Thesis
Country:ChinaCandidate:P F DongFull Text:PDF
GTID:2518306308474834Subject:Computer technology
Abstract/Summary:PDF Full Text Request
With the rapid development of the Internet of Things technology,people's daily life is gradually becoming intelligent and informational,and the foundation supporting the application of the Internet of Things is the information collection of Internet of Things resources.For the IoT resource access system,we expect it to receive and process more IoT information within a certain period of time,reducing consumption and improving efficiency.This article analyzes the large connection and high concurrent access requirements of IoT resources,and designs a set of IoT resource access systems.The main work and contributions include the following three aspects:(1)Design a multi-level,highly concurrent IoT resource access system framework.A resource description and mapping method is designed,and the raw data is converted into observation data with practical significance by binding the resource entity and the protocol.On this machine,the self-matching of IoT resource connection and message mode is implemented concurrently,preventing data pollution.For large-scale IoT resource access,a multi-service node collaboration and task dynamic allocation mechanism is designed to ensure high concurrency of the system.(2)Design and implementation of self-adaptive and self-assembled IoT access protocol stack.The IoT resources are heterogeneous,and different protocols are used at the physical layer,network layer,application layer and other layers to access the system.This article refines the protocol stack structure suitable for the Internet of Things resource access.With this structure,users can customize of each layer of the protocol stack or perform secondary development,and the system completes the automatic identification,loading,and assembly of the protocol stack.The multi-layer protocol stack can automatically combine the protocol stack according to the message to complete the self-adaptation of the Internet of Things resource access.The system implements hot-plugging functions of dynamic access,deletion,and no downtime.(3)Design of the uninterrupted service guarantee mechanism for the service cluster of the Internet of Things system.Based on the internal forensics technology,real-time monitoring and analysis of the running status of the front-end thread of the server node is realized,the abnormality of the front-end thread is quickly found,and the switching of the service node is triggered.This paper proposes an improved load balancing algorithm that takes into account factors such as CPU and memory of service nodes.In order to prevent packet loss and packet loss during service node switching,a hierarchical design of message queues is adopted,and protocol data packet shared storage and on-demand scheduling and distribution mechanisms are proposed to ensure lossless reception and orderly processing of protocol data packets.An intermediate state description table for the IoT protocol was designed,and the method for updating the intermediate state of the protocol communication process was analyzed to implement state migration.The system has been applied to the important national science and technology infrastructure in the "13th Five-Year Plan"-High Precision Ground-Based Time Service System(GTSS),which initially meets the needs of project resource access and information collection.
Keywords/Search Tags:resource access, load balancing, dynamic loading, perception protocol analysis
PDF Full Text Request
Related items